Chhaya Néné is a multimedia journalist and actress with a passion for helping people. Néné's work as a one-woman band expands from Miami to England, India, and Los Angeles. She has contributed to Reader's Digest, India.com, Headlines Today, Zee TV, NBC, The Washington Post, and more.
Néné graduated from her program as Valedictorian with a Master of Arts in Journalism from the University of Southern California and is currently based in Los Angeles. On the acting side, you can find Nene on 'The OA Part Two", "Speechless", "A Crooked Somebody" and more.
Abigail Bassett is an experienced journalist, writer, conference and video host, and video producer with more than 15 years of diverse experience in writing, video production, and editorial management. A winner of numerous awards, including two Emmys, Abigail has worked with Fortune 500 companies & start-ups to raise brand awareness through compelling storytelling and partnerships. She previously was the Executive Producer for auto site Edmunds and she spent 10 years as a senior producer at CNN. She is currently a full-time freelance journalist covering health and wellness, lifestyle, travel, automotive, and business content. She is also a certified yoga teacher.
Shereen Marisol Meraji is the co-host and senior producer of NPR's Code Switch the preeminent podcast about race, culture and identity in the U.S. She's worked in audio storytelling for nearly two decades and is an expert in the field.
